Bernadette Giorgi: Attitude Tu Review

I'm a fitness professional and have been in the industry for over 15 years, so my fitness level is highly advanced. With that said, I didn't expect much from this workout--I thought it'd be too easy for me. However, I was surprised to find Attitude Tu is highly effective and challenging. I used the heaviest resistance band available, and got quite a burn in my muscles. This workout is a fantastic counterpart to my traditional heavy weight training, particularly the lengthening, ballet-type moves for the lower body. Definitely a keeper!

Pilates Circle Challenge uses the Pilates Circle to keep your body in the proper alignment to activate and engage specific muscle groups during the workout. You don't have to have a Pilates Circle to do the workout, but it totally makes it more challenging (and fun). The resistance of the Pilates Circle sculpts hard to tone areas, giving you beautifully defined arms, toned flat abs, a slim waist and hips, lean thighs, and a great rear! Pilates Circle Challenge begins with a calming stretch to ready your mind and body. Then you will work your entire core and lower body while engaging your upper body as well. You will end with a gentle stretch to improve flexibility. Running time: approximately 50 minutes.
